This report reviews the capabilities of the Navy's full-scale damage control RDT&E platform, ex-USS Shadwell (LSD-15). The ex-USS Shadwell serves as the ultimate test platform in the development of fire fighting agents, DC systems, predictive models and technology stemming from basic and theoretical concepts developed through naval research. As a complete Navy platform, it enables consolidation of research developments from laboratories, system commands, industry and the fleet to assess technology and DC doctrine in a realistic shipboard damage environment. Thus, the ex-USS Shadwell provides a very versatile and realistic test bed for finalizing the fruits of research and development that are on their way to the fleet.
